You, Me and Thing: The Dreaded Noodle-Doodles

£4.99

Ruby and Jackson get the surprise of their lives when they discover a Thing living at the bottom of their gardens. But Thing is cute, and funny, even if sometimes when he's upset he gets a bit ARRGHH! And that's when the trouble starts. Like the time he comes to school, and Ruby and Jackson find themselves mixed up in a terrible tangle of noodle-doodles!

The second in a hilarious new series by best-selling author Karen McCombie, illustrated throughout with irresistable black-and-white line art by Alex T. Smith.
